# T5 Email Summarizer - Brief & Full

## Model Description

This is a fine-tuned T5-small model specialized for email summarization. The model can generate both brief (one-line) and detailed (comprehensive) summaries of emails, and is robust to messy, informal inputs with typos and abbreviations.

### Key Features
- **Dual-mode summarization**: Supports both `summarize_brief:` and `summarize_full:` prefixes
- **Robust to informal text**: Handles typos, abbreviations, and casual language
- **Fast inference**: Based on T5-small (60M parameters)
- **Production-ready**: Optimized for real-world email processing

## Intended Uses & Limitations

### Intended Uses
- Summarizing professional and casual emails
- Email inbox management and prioritization
- Meeting invitation processing
- Customer support email triage
- Newsletter summarization

### Limitations
- Maximum input length: 512 tokens (~2500 characters)
- English language only
- May miss nuanced context in very long email threads
- Not suitable for legal or medical document summarization

## Training Data

The model was fine-tuned on the [argilla/FinePersonas-Conversations-Email-Summaries](https://huggingface.co/datasets/argilla/FinePersonas-Conversations-Email-Summaries) dataset containing 364,000 email-summary pairs with:
- Professional business emails
- Casual informal communications
- Meeting invitations and updates
- Technical discussions
- Customer service interactions

Training data was augmented with:
- Subtle typos and misspellings (50% of examples)
- Common abbreviations (pls, thx, tmrw, etc.)
- Various formatting styles

## Training Procedure

### Training Details
- **Base model**: google/t5-v1_1-small
- **Training epochs**: 1
- **Batch size**: 64
- **Learning rate**: 3e-4
- **Validation split**: 1%
- **Hardware**: NVIDIA GPU with mixed precision (fp16)
- **Framework**: HuggingFace Transformers 4.36.0

### Preprocessing
- Emails formatted as: `Subject: [subject]. Body: [content]`
- Two training examples created per email (brief and full summaries)
- Data augmentation applied to 50% of examples

## How to Use

### Installation
```bash
pip install transformers torch
```

### Basic Usage
```python
from transformers import T5ForConditionalGeneration, T5Tokenizer

# Load model and tokenizer
tokenizer = T5Tokenizer.from_pretrained("Wordcab/t5-small-email-summarizer")
model = T5ForConditionalGeneration.from_pretrained("Wordcab/t5-small-email-summarizer")

# Example email
email = """Subject: Team Meeting Tomorrow. Body: Hi everyone, 
Just a reminder that we have our weekly team meeting tomorrow at 2 PM EST. 
Please prepare your status updates and any blockers you're facing. 
We'll also discuss the Q4 roadmap. Thanks!"""

# Generate brief summary
inputs = tokenizer(f"summarize_brief: {email}", return_tensors="pt", max_length=512, truncation=True)
outputs = model.generate(**inputs, max_length=50, num_beams=2)
brief_summary = tokenizer.decode(outputs[0], skip_special_tokens=True)
print(f"Brief: {brief_summary}")

# Generate full summary
inputs = tokenizer(f"summarize_full: {email}", return_tensors="pt", max_length=512, truncation=True)
outputs = model.generate(**inputs, max_length=150, num_beams=2)
full_summary = tokenizer.decode(outputs[0], skip_special_tokens=True)
print(f"Full: {full_summary}")
```

## Performance Metrics

### Evaluation Results
- **ROUGE-L Score**: 0.42
- **Average inference time**: 0.63s (brief), 0.71s (full) on T4 GPU
- **Coherence score on messy inputs**: 80%

### Comparison with Base Model
- 8.3% improvement in quality over base Falconsai/text_summarization
- Successfully differentiates brief vs full summaries (2.5x length difference)
- Better handling of informal text and typos
